Access violation vulnerability in HT Mega 2.4.7

The HT Mega plugin for WordPress is not completely secure and can potentially allow unauthorized people to access private data. This is because the plugin’s duplicate() function does not have enough checks in place. This means that anyone with contributor-level or higher access can duplicate any post, even if it contains sensitive information.

Detected in:

HT Mega – Absolute Addons For Elementor fixed vulnerable versions: >= * <= 2.4.7
